You know that first smell you get when you enter your home? Not your rented make-shift home, but the home your grew up in home. I realised just how MUCH I love that smell when I walked into my home today. It was a smell that said, hey, everything will be fine and I love you anyway.
This time of course, I'm not planning to run away for months on end, but I need this energy. I was beginning to feel like iron man out of charge. So now... see you later alligator (haha, I haven't said that forever).

